LLC minutes are very detailed notes taken during a meeting of the members (or owners) of a Limited Liability Company (LLC).
Annual Report Unlike most other states, Arizona does not require LLCs to file annual reports.
Although no Arizona statute or case requires annual meetings or special meetings of the members or managers of an Arizona LLC as an Arizona LLC attorney who has formed 8,000+ Arizona LLCs I recommend that both types of meetings be held. Any LLC member can propose a resolution, but all members must vote on it. Typically a majority of the members is needed to pass the resolution, but each LLC may have different voting rights. Some LLCs give a different value to each member's vote based on their percentage of interest in the company.

Although an Arizona limited liability company is not required to have a written Operating Agreement, it is in the best interest of multiple-member companies to adopt a comprehensive Operating Agreement that sets forth their rights and obligations with respect to the company.

Generally, states don't require LLCs to hold annual member meetings and write minutes. An LLC's operating agreement, however, may require annual meetings and recording of minutes. When that's the case, it's critical for the LLC to follow through with that requirement to demonstrate adherence to business compliance.
